Lydia Ann BARBER was born 15 June 1835 in Vernon, Oneida, New York, USA

Lydia Ann BARBER was the child of ?   and   ?

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Lydia Ann  married  George CLARKE October 1860 .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
George CLARKE  was born 15 April 1833 in County Cavan, Ireland.  George died 19 January 1921 in Ocean Grove, New Jersey, USA. 

Lydia Ann BARBER died 25 March 1908 in Westfield, Union, New Jersey, USA.





daughter of Jonathan Barber and Elizabeth Eaton
